The 345-gram tea cake of medium density easily separates into twisted brown leaves, buds, and thin cuttings. The aroma is restrained, woody and balsamic. The infusion is transparent, with an amber hue.
The bouquet of the finished tea is mature, woody and fruity, with notes of spicy herbs and autumn leaves. The aroma is deep and warm, complex, woody and fruity. The taste is full and smooth, pleasantly tart, sweet, with fruity acidity, nuances of spice, and a long, refreshing finish.
How to brew
Steaming
- Teaware: porcelain or clay teapot / gaiwan
- Water: 85-90°C
- Ratio of dry tea leaves: 4-5 g. per 100 ml water
The first steeping is for rinsing the tea.
Brew in short infusions of 5-7 seconds, gradually increasing the time by 5-10 seconds.
Infusion method
- Teaware: porcelain or clay teapot
- Water: 85-90°C
- Ratio of dry tea leaves: 1 g. per 100 ml of water
Infuse for 3-5 minutes.
